description abstract | Vehicle systems have represented the primary area of interest and application in the multibody dynamics community for a very long time. The complexities and diversity of such systems provide rich platforms for the development of new modeling theory and techniques, new computational approaches and methodologies, and new research directions in general. The literature accumulated over the years in treating various aspects of vehicle systems in a multibody dynamics context is vast and broad in topics covered. While it is not feasible to aim at creating a comprehensive volume of multibody dynamics studies for vehicle systems, by putting together this special issue, the editors would like to bring into the spotlight current related research efforts and advanced approaches. Thus, a collection of high quality technical papers discussing stateoftheart research in multibody dynamics investigations, methods, algorithms, and other scientific tools with direct applications to a variety of vehicle systems is presented here. It is interesting to notice the wide range of vehicle systems applications, as well as the research needs identified as future directions for each of them. | |
